Council of Hierarchs of Slovak Greek Catholic Church Expresses Unity with People of Ukraine

30.01.2014, 09:56

The Council of Hierarchs of the Greek Catholic Church of Slovakia expressed its sympathy to the people of neighboring Ukraine who are now experiencing difficult times.

“We call on priests, if possible, in the coming days to celebrate the Divine Liturgy or to include in the Liturgy a request for peace and a just resolution to the crisis in Ukraine.

“We invite the faithful of the Slovak Greek Catholic Church to pray for the peaceful resolution of the tense situation, to keep the Commandments of God and the principles of solidarity and democracy,” Bishop Jan Babiak, Archbishop of Presov, wrote in a letter to the head of the Ukrainian Greek Catholic Church Patriarch Sviatoslav Shevchuk.

Furthermore, it should be noted that religious media outlets in Slovakia are widely covering the events that are taking place these days in Ukraine, the Information Department of the UGCC reports.
